- Description
- Predicted to contribute to monoatomic cation channel activity. Acts upstream of or within several processes, including liver development; lymphangiogenesis; and regulation of collagen biosynthetic process. Predicted to be located in cilium; endomembrane system; and membrane. Predicted to be active in plasma membrane. Is expressed in several structures, including head; neuromast; notochord; pectoral fin bud; and pronephros. Used to study autosomal dominant polycystic kidney disease and polycystic liver disease. Human ortholog(s) of this gene implicated in autosomal dominant polycystic kidney disease; intracranial aneurysm; and polycystic kidney disease 1. Orthologous to human PKD1 (polycystin 1, transient receptor potential channel interacting).
